Voodoo In The Bible

What does the Bible say about voodoo?

Voodoo is indeed real and it is practiced in many places in the U.S. like Miami, New Orleans, and New York. For information, check out, “is voodoo real?” I’ve met many people who have said voodoo is not sinful it’s just a religion, but that is a lie from the father of all lies. Divination, witchcraft, and necromancy is clearly condemned in Scripture and there is no way of justifying rebellion. Did you know that some people even use voodoo to bring the dead back to life? Christians should never even think about practicing voodoo. We should always put our trust in God because He will handle all our problems.

Evilness should never be an option for anyone. God has nothing to do with the devil and that is what voodoo is, it’s working for the devil. You’re letting demonic influences into your life and they will harm you. You hear about many people in Haiti and Africa who go to voodoo priests for healing, and it is sad. It might seem safe at the time, but any healing from Satan is extremely dangerous! Shouldn’t people seek their God instead? Deceived people go to voodoo priests for things like love, false protection, and to cause harm, but rest assured that a Christian can never be harmed by the evilness of Satan.

Bible verses about voodoo

1. Leviticus 19:31 Do not defile yourselves by turning to mediums or to those who consult the spirits of the dead. I am the LORD your God.

2. Deuteronomy 18:10-14 You must never sacrifice your sons or daughters by burning them alive, practice black magic, be a fortuneteller, witch, or sorcerer, cast spells, ask ghosts or spirits for help, or consult the dead. Whoever does these things is disgusting to the Lord. The Lord your God is forcing these nations out of your way because of their disgusting practices. You must have integrity in dealing with the Lord your God. These nations you are forcing out listen to fortunetellers and to those who practice black magic. But the Lord your God won’t let you do anything like that.

3. Leviticus 19:26 Do not eat meat that has not been drained of its blood. “Do not practice fortune-telling or witchcraft.

4. Isaiah 8:19 Someone may say to you, “Let’s ask the mediums and those who consult the spirits of the dead. With their whisperings and mutterings, they will tell us what to do.” But shouldn’t people ask God for guidance? Should the living seek guidance from the dead?
